Translation:
Then Lord Brahmā, by his ability to be hidden from vision, created the Siddhas and Vidyādharas and gave them that wonderful form of his known as the Antardhāna.
Purport:
Antardhāna means that these living creatures can be perceived to be present, but they cannot be seen by vision.
